#640d41 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#640d41 is composed of 39.2% red, 5.1%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87% magenta, 35%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 324.1 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 22.2%. #640d41 color hex could be obtained by blending #c81a82 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#640d41 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#640d41 has RGB values of R:100, G:13,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.35,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6556993.

Shades and Tints of #640d41
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0209 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.
